The resolution to the "Extraction failed 7" dilemma involves a process of elimination that benefits the user’s overall system hygiene. First, the user should verify the integrity of the archive by attempting to open it with a standalone version of 7-Zip or WinRAR. If these programs fail, the file is corrupt and requires re-downloading—preferably via an external browser. If the file opens externally, the issue lies with MO2’s environment. The user should check their installation path, ensuring MO2 is placed in a neutral directory (e.g., C:\Modding\MO2 ) rather than a system-protected one. Furthermore, enabling "Long Path Support" in the Windows registry or shortening the MO2 instance name can bypass the character limit restrictions that plague heavy modding setups.

While MO2 comes bundled with its own version of 7-Zip, a conflict with a system-wide installation can cause issues. If you have 7-Zip installed on your PC, try uninstalling it . Then, force MO2 to re-extract its bundled version by creating a new, portable instance. This ensures that MO2 is using the correct version of the tool with the proper settings.
